Man charged after chase

A Weldon area man was arrested Thursday after about a mile-and-half chase on Trueblood Road and Highway 125, Lieutenant Chuck Hasty of the Halifax County Sheriff’s reported in a news release.

Narcotics Agent Tim Harris was on patrol in the Weldon and responded to a call a larceny just occurred on Trueblood Road. 

Agent Harris was in the area when he spotted the vehicle the man, Thomas Wayne Banty, was driving.  Agent Harris attempted to stop the vehicle but the man refused to. 

Agent Harris continued to pursue Banty until the he pulled into his front yard, where Agent Harris took Banty into custody without further incident. 

Banty was charged with driving with a revoked license and failing to stop for blue light and siren. The larceny remains under investigation, Hasty told The Spin. Speeds in the chase never reached more than 60 mph.

Banty’s next court date is Oct. 26 and his bond was $500.
